2.1 Bash. Пишем скрипты в Linux
📝 Как писать автоматические скрипты для обработки логов в Linux
📝 Как писать автоматические скрипты для обработки логов в Linux Привет, любители автоматизации! 🚀 Знаете ли вы, что правильная обработка логов — это залог стабильной системы? Сегодня расскажу, как создать простенький скрипт, который поможет быстро анализировать необычные события. Что делать, если лог-файл растет быстро? - Используем команду tail для просмотра последних строк: tail -n 50 /var/log/syslog - Можно искать ошибки или предупреждения с помощью grep: grep "error" /var/log/syslog - Для автоматизации — напишем скрипт, который будет проверять лог каждую минуту и уведомлять о новых ошибках...
🖥️ Создаем удобный и понятный лог-файл для скриптов на Linux
🖥️ Создаем удобный и понятный лог-файл для скриптов на Linux Добро пожаловать, коллеги! 🚀 Работа с логами — сердце автоматизации и мониторинга. Сегодня расскажу, как сделать логирование в Bash максимально простым и практичным. - Используйте перенаправление для записи ошибок и информации: exec > >(tee -a /var/log/myscript.log) 2>&1 - Или добавляйте логгирование к конкретным командам: command >> /var/log/myscript.log 2>&1 Плюсы правильной настройки: - Можно отслеживать работу скрипта в реальном времени - Обеспечивается историческая запись для анализа - Упрощается отладка и устранение ошибок...